Defective Drugs

Prescription drugs, over-the counter drugs, chemical exposure at work or home, and environmental hazards are all at fault for a variety of birth defects. The cost of these medical conditions is enormous. Parents often ask themselves what caused their child's health condition and where to turn if bills for expensive procedures and treatments pile up.

Drug manufacturers must test their products rigorously before they are released for sale, and are expected to be aware of any possible adverse effects. They could be held accountable for lawsuits involving product liability filed by consumers if they fail to do this. An experienced birth defect attorney can help determine if a defective medication may be to blame for the health issues of your child.

If you suspect that the birth defect of your child is related to a specific drug, start by documenting your symptoms and saving the medicine packaging and receipts. It is also important to record the date you first began to notice symptoms in your child. This information is essential for determining the statutes of limitations.

You have one year to file a suit if your child was exposed any toxic substance that contributed to the condition. Product Liability

Birth defects and birth injuries continue to occur despite the fact that modern medical technology has drastically reduced the risks associated with pregnancy. These conditions can have a major impact on the lives of both parents and infants.

While many birth defects and injuries result from environmental or genetic factors they may also be due to health care providers' negligence during pregnancy or during delivery. These errors include prescribing incorrect medications or failing to monitor the mother for signs of prenatal damage.

The distinction between a birth injury and a birth defect may be confusing. Although birth injuries can occur during labor and birth and birth defects are a result of the womb. They usually have a long-term impact on the body of the fetus' structure or function.

If a child is born with defects in the birth process because of someone else's negligence act or failure to act or act appropriately, the child may be entitled to compensation. The compensation is paid to the victim and held in trust for the benefit of the child.
